Lines Matching refs:ihx
204 PetscReal ihx = 1. / hx; in RDDiffusion() local
214 dfluxL[0].E = -ihx * D_L + (0.5 * dD_L.E - ihx * dxD_L.E) * nx_L.E; in RDDiffusion()
215 dfluxL[1].E = +ihx * D_L + (0.5 * dD_L.E + ihx * dxD_L.E) * nx_L.E; in RDDiffusion()
216 dfluxL[0].T = (0.5 * dD_L.T - ihx * dxD_L.T) * nx_L.E; in RDDiffusion()
217 dfluxL[1].T = (0.5 * dD_L.T + ihx * dxD_L.T) * nx_L.E; in RDDiffusion()
225 dfluxR[0].E = -ihx * D_R + (0.5 * dD_R.E - ihx * dxD_R.E) * nx_R.E; in RDDiffusion()
226 dfluxR[1].E = +ihx * D_R + (0.5 * dD_R.E + ihx * dxD_R.E) * nx_R.E; in RDDiffusion()
227 dfluxR[0].T = (0.5 * dD_R.T - ihx * dxD_R.T) * nx_R.E; in RDDiffusion()
228 dfluxR[1].T = (0.5 * dD_R.T + ihx * dxD_R.T) * nx_R.E; in RDDiffusion()
231 d[0].E = -ihx * dfluxL[0].E; in RDDiffusion()
232 d[0].T = -ihx * dfluxL[0].T; in RDDiffusion()
233 d[1].E = ihx * (dfluxR[0].E - dfluxL[1].E); in RDDiffusion()
234 d[1].T = ihx * (dfluxR[0].T - dfluxL[1].T); in RDDiffusion()
235 d[2].E = ihx * dfluxR[1].E; in RDDiffusion()
236 d[2].T = ihx * dfluxR[1].T; in RDDiffusion()
238 return ihx * (fluxR - fluxL); in RDDiffusion()